Improving Trash Management in the Kitchen with Custom-Fit Refill Bags

Effective trash management in the kitchen requires more than just a bin; it requires the right accessories. Choosing compact trash bags tailored specifically for in-cupboard setups is crucial.

  • Tailored bags offer a snug fit, ensuring they won’t slip or bunch up during use.
  • Look for tear-resistant properties to prevent spills or breaks when pulling out a full bag.
  • Bags with odor-control features help ensure your kitchen smells fresh in tight quarters.
  • By selecting the right refills, you enhance the overall hygiene of your living space.

Apartment Storage Hacks and Trash Management in the Kitchen

Living in a condo requires creative trash management in the kitchen and storage solutions. To maximize your space:

  1. Utilize Vertical Space: Use wall-mounted racks to save counter room.
  2. Multi-purpose Furniture: Consider islands with hidden compartments.
  3. Concealed Disposal: Incorporate a compact trash can system that fits snugly into your existing cabinetry.

  2. How can I improve trash management in the kitchen to prevent odors? Effective trash management in the kitchen starts with a lid that seals properly and the use of high-quality, odor-control trash bags. Additionally, a trash can system that utilizes compact bags encourages more frequent disposal, which prevents waste from sitting long enough to create significant odors in a tight space.
